如何优化服务器数据库配置以降低费用?

在当今数字化时代,企业对于服务器数据库的需求越来越大。随着数据量的不断增加,服务器数据库的成本也逐渐成为企业的负担。为了有效降低服务器数据库配置成本,以下是一些有效的优化策略。

1. 选择合适的数据库类型

不同的业务场景适合不同类型的数据库。关系型数据库(如MySQL、Oracle等)适用于结构化数据存储和复杂查询;非关系型数据库(如MongoDB、Cassandra等)则更适合处理大规模的非结构化或半结构化数据。根据实际需求选择合适类型的数据库可以减少不必要的资源消耗,进而降低成本。

2. 合理规划存储空间

定期清理无用数据,只保留必要的历史记录;对冷热数据进行分离存储,将不常用的数据迁移到成本更低廉的存储介质上;压缩数据以节省磁盘空间。通过以上措施,在满足业务需求的同时最大程度地减少存储开销。

3. 调整硬件资源配置

根据应用程序的工作负载特点调整CPU、内存等硬件参数。避免过度配置导致资源浪费,也不要因为配置过低而影响性能。可以通过监控工具实时了解服务器状态,并据此做出相应调整。

4. 优化查询语句

编写高效的SQL查询语句能够显著提高数据库的响应速度并减少I/O操作次数。例如:使用索引加速检索过程;尽量避免全表扫描;合理利用缓存机制等。

5. 实施自动化运维管理

引入自动化运维工具来简化日常维护工作流程,如备份恢复、补丁更新等。这不仅有助于提高工作效率,还能及时发现潜在问题,防止因故障造成的额外开支。

6. 采用云服务提供商

云计算提供了按需付费模式,用户只需为自己实际使用的资源付费。大多数云平台都提供了丰富的数据库产品和服务选项,可以根据具体需求灵活选择最合适的方案。云服务商通常会提供专业团队支持和技术保障,确保系统稳定运行。

7. 定期评估与调整

随着业务的发展变化以及技术进步,原有配置可能不再是最优解。因此建议每隔一段时间重新审视当前设置,结合最新情况作出适当调整。

通过对服务器数据库配置进行精心规划和持续优化,可以在保证性能的前提下有效控制成本。希望上述建议能为相关从业者提供参考价值。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/136642.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2天前
下一篇 2天前

相关推荐

  • 如何在ASP.NET应用程序中确保并发操作的数据一致性?

    在ASP.NET应用程序中,多个用户可能同时执行读取和写入数据库的操作。当这些并发操作涉及相同的数据时,可能会导致数据不一致的问题。为了解决这些问题,我们需要采取适当的措施来确保数据的一致性。 理解并发控制 并发控制是数据库管理系统用来管理多个事务对共享资源(如表、行)的同时访问的技术。在ASP.NET应用中,我们通常使用关系型数据库(如SQL Server…

    1天前
    300
  • SQL数据库备份加密:保护敏感信息在传输过程中的安全

    随着信息技术的飞速发展,企业和个人对于数据安全性的要求越来越高。特别是在处理大量敏感信息的情况下,如何确保这些信息的安全性就成为了至关重要的问题。作为企业信息化建设的重要组成部分,SQL数据库存储着企业的核心业务数据,因此对SQL数据库进行有效的备份和加密是保证数据完整性、可用性和保密性的关键环节。 一、为什么要对SQL数据库备份进行加密 1. 保护数据隐私…

    3天前
    1100
  • 如何优化 MySQL 数据库还原速度以应对紧急恢复需求?

    在企业级应用中,数据的安全性和可靠性至关重要。尤其是在发生灾难性事件时,快速有效地恢复数据库成为关键。本文将探讨如何优化 MySQL 数据库的还原速度,确保在紧急情况下能够迅速恢复正常业务。 选择合适的备份策略 1. 增量备份与全量备份结合: 全量备份虽然安全可靠,但耗时较长。而增量备份只记录自上次备份以来的变化部分,可以显著减少备份文件大小和时间。定期进行…

    2天前
    300
  • 云主机上部署数据库时遇到的权限配置问题及解决方法

    随着云计算的发展,越来越多的企业选择将数据库部署在云主机上。在实际操作过程中,我们可能会遇到各种各样的权限配置问题。本文将介绍几个常见的权限配置问题及其解决方案,帮助大家顺利地完成数据库部署。 一、无法连接到数据库 当用户尝试连接云主机上的数据库时,经常会出现“Access denied”或“Connection refused”的错误提示。这可能是由于以下…

    2天前
    400
  • MySQL用户认证方式有哪些,如何选择最适合的认证方式?

    在MySQL数据库系统中,用户认证是确保只有授权用户才能访问和操作数据库的重要环节。随着技术的发展,MySQL提供了多种用户认证方式,以适应不同的安全需求和应用场景。选择最适合的认证方式取决于多个因素,包括安全性、性能、易用性以及具体的业务需求。本文将介绍常见的MySQL用户认证方式,并探讨如何根据实际需求选择最合适的认证方法。 1. 传统密码认证(Nati…

    3天前
    400

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部